The complexity of modern-day digital gadgets has demanded more detailed PCB styles. PCB design entails the design of the digital circuit on a board utilizing numerous software program tools that assist in creating schematics and preparing the physical positioning of components. In the design phase, designers must think about factors such as thermal administration, signal honesty, and electromagnetic compatibility. Great PCB design can maximize the performance of the gadget and minimize the potential for failing, making it a critical aspect of establishing digital products. With the raising miniaturization of tools, there is a growing requirement for small styles that can still handle high levels of complexity. Developers progressively depend on simulation and modeling tools to predict how a circuit will certainly act prior to making the board, reducing the threat of errors and enhancing total efficiency.

One of the most fascinating innovations in the realm of PCB design is the arrival of multilayer flexible PCBs. Multilayer flexible PCBs combine the benefits of flexible and stiff circuits, enabling them to turn or flex without jeopardizing performance. The design of multilayer flexible PCBs entails layering numerous substratums, usually a mix of plastic and resin materials, which permits for better circuit thickness and boosted efficiency.

With the boosting emphasis on sustainability and ecological duty, many PCB manufacturers are exploring environmentally friendly materials and processes. Advancements such as lead-free soldering and the usage of recyclable substratums not just assist reduce the environmental footprint of electronic products but can also function as a marketing point for eco mindful consumers. As laws around digital waste become extra rigid, adopting greener production techniques can place business favorably in the marketplace.
